The recent outbreak of the Novel Coronavirus disease (COVID-19) is a serious threat to people all over the world. In order to understand and develop an effective drug against this virus (Severe Acute Respiratory Syndrome Coronavirus 2: SARS-CoV-2), structural work on the related proteins has already started and the resultant entries are accumulating in the PDB. PDBj provides a portal page for the COVID-19 related entries for our users. New entries will be added simultaneously with the public release from the wwPDB.

The tab "All entries" contains all PDB IDs, in case you want to check all independent entries, including group depositions by the same authors. The "Repr. entries" tab contains only representative PDB entries with the highest resolution, excluding duplicate entries with 100% amino acid sequence identitiy, even if they contain a different ligand. Finally, the "Latest entries" tab contains the latest entries released this week.
